KBWR: High LTD Ratios, Weak Fundamentals Are Reasons To Avoid Small Regional Banks
KBWR is currently comprised of 50 U.S. stocks whose companies are primarily engaged in the regional banking industry, as determined by an Index Committee. KBWR primarily holds small-caps, while its counterpart, KBWB, handles the larger banks. Unfortunately for KBWR shareholders, it's those larger banks that have substantially outperformed over the last 14 years. A possible reason is that small commercial banks have a much higher loan-to-deposit ratio. After a brief reprieve in 2021-2022, the average ratio is back up above 80%.
